{"value"=>"A. L. S. Endorsed with an opinion that the letter should be forwarded express to [Dyre] Kearney, and that [Thomas] Rodney should be acquainted with the contents; signed, \"as a Member of the Legislature of the Delaware State,\" Feb. 15, by Geo: Read. 1 page. 4o", "format"=>"simple"}
abstract
{"value"=>"The question of a removal of Congress to Philadelphia is shortly to be agitated; urges him to attend or to send some other member of the delegation in order to give the voice of Delaware; he will be received with open arms by all the southern states; the thing must be done before the 21st, for then the times of the South Carolina delegates expire."}
